Abdullah Khan is a scholar working on Artificial Intelligence, Computer Vision and Pattern Recognition and Geophysics. According to data from OpenAlex, Abdullah Khan has authored 82 papers receiving a total of 962 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 32 papers in Artificial Intelligence, 13 papers in Computer Vision and Pattern Recognition and 10 papers in Geophysics. Recurrent topics in Abdullah Khan's work include Metaheuristic Optimization Algorithms Research (12 papers), Neural Networks and Applications (11 papers) and Geological and Geochemical Analysis (10 papers). Abdullah Khan is often cited by papers focused on Metaheuristic Optimization Algorithms Research (12 papers), Neural Networks and Applications (11 papers) and Geological and Geochemical Analysis (10 papers). Abdullah Khan collaborates with scholars based in Pakistan, Malaysia and Saudi Arabia. Abdullah Khan's co-authors include Nazri Mohd Nawi, Muhammad Zubair Rehman, Haruna Chiroma, Asfandyar Khan, Javed Iqbal Bangash, Tutut Herawan, Muhammad Imran, Muhammad Asim, S. M. Casshyap and Abdulsalam Ya’u Gital and has published in prestigious journals such as S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ología, PLoS ONE and Scientific Reports.
